A Hymn for St Cecilia by Malcolm Archer Divisi - Sheet Music
By Malcolm Archerfor SATB (with divisions) and organ This work is by turns joyous and reflective. Rich harmonies, shifting tonalities, and expressive melodies combine to evoke the changing moods explored within the text. The poignant Andante section gives way to increasingly jubilant and powerful writing that brings the work to an ecstatic conclusion.
